ESG Program Specialist IV Salary in the United States

How much does an ESG Program Specialist IV make in the United States?

As of March 01, 2026, the average salary for an ESG Program Specialist IV in the United States is $113,840 per year, which breaks down to an hourly rate of $55.

However, an ESG Program Specialist IV's salary can vary significantly. Here’s a look at the typical salary range:

  • Top Earners (90th percentile): $158,078
  • Majority Range (25th-75th percentile): $97,570 to $136,996
  • Entry-Level (10th percentile): $82,757

How Experience Level Affects ESG Program Specialist Salaries?

Experience is a primary driver of an ESG Program Specialist IV's salary. As you build your skills and take on more complex tasks, your compensation generally increases. Here's how the average salary grows at different career stages:

  • ESG Program Specialist II (2-4 years): $75,226
  • ESG Program Specialist III (4-7 years): $94,233
  • ESG Program Specialist IV (7+ years): $113,840
  • ESG Program Specialist V (7-10 years): $140,132
  • ESG Program Manager (10+ years): $112,900

4. What are the responsibilities of ESG Program Specialist IV?

Develops, implements, and monitors environmental, social, and governance (ESG) initiatives to align with corporate sustainability and ethical strategy. Analyzes ESG data, prepares reports, and ensures compliance with regulatory requirements and industry standards. Collaborates with internal teams and external stakeholders to drive responsible business practices. Identifies opportunities for improvement, tracks performance metrics, and supports ESG-related projects and campaigns. Typically requires a bachelor's degree. Typically reports to a manager. Work is highly independent. May assume a team lead role for the work group. A specialist on complex technical and business matters. Typically requires 7+ years of related experience.
